Harlem residents continue to rally in front of vacant building

Silent Voices United Inc. and the St. Nicholas Homes Resident Affiliation continued their calls for for inexpensive housing at 2201 Adam Clayton Powell Jr Blvd. this previous weekend. They gathered in entrance of the vacant luxurious constructing.

“Our mission is to present a voice to those that don’t have any voice,” stated Tiffany Fulton, who heads Silent Voices United. “We stand united, a various group with a shared function.”

In response to town, the unique developer went bankrupt and the brand new proprietor was going to lease the constructing to a nonprofit with the belief that it will be used as a shelter for asylum seekers. The group realized town had not held a public discussion board or knowledgeable Group Board 10 of any plans for the 53-unit constructing in query at 2201 Adam Clayton Powell Jr. Blvd. Organizers angrily railed in opposition to assets not being prioritized for residents and put the phrase out to come back collectively to cease it, which prompted Mayor Eric Adams to go to the group twice to attempt to easy issues over.

Final week, property house owners allowed residents on a walkthrough of the constructing the place they weren’t allowed to take photos, they stated. Fulton stated that the group’s calls for for the vacant constructing to be slated for everlasting low-income focused housing usually are not being met by town or the house owners. 

Ruth McDaniels, one other organizer, stated that the Black group in Harlem has been neglected for many years. “Sufficient is sufficient,” stated McDaniels. “That’s the place we’re proper now. We’re not going to only sit again and permit folks, mayors, or governors, or anybody for that matter, to only are available and inform us that they’re going to permit folks to come back in and take our housing.” 

Manhattan Democratic District Chief for the 70 Meeting District William Allen spoke on the rally concerning the Harlem group being “offered out” for the sake of gentrification a era in the past, which has led to a dearth of inexpensive housing.

“Gentrification is a public coverage, your authorities helps that. That’s a authorities coverage that claims that we need to transfer you out,” stated Allen. “So your presence and continued presence means loads.”Allen inspired the teams to maintain stress on native politicians for outcomes.“Our workplace has been made conscious of plans to vary using this constructing and we stand with you that this group is an lively participant within the housing plan happening on this district,” stated Shanny Herrera, who’s the District Supervisor for Councilmember Yusef Salaam. “We sit up for being a part of the dialog.”   

Longtime Harlem resident Trevor Whittingham is a local of Jamaica who owns a locksmith and ironmongery shop within the metropolis. He claims rightful possession of the vacant constructing and asserted that he’s been in court docket since 2011 making an attempt to get his property again. In response to the New York Metropolis Division of Finance Workplace of the Metropolis Register, Whittingham has proven up on the deed info for the constructing for not less than a decade. He stated the constructing was put in a belief which he’s the only real beneficiary of.

Craig Schley and Shana Harmongoff, meeting candidates within the upcoming seventieth District race, additionally made an look on the rally.
